摘要
采用HE、Giemsa染色、透射电镜以及DNA琼脂糖凝胶电泳等研究了水泡性口炎病毒(VSV)诱导BHK-21细胞凋亡的过程。结果显示:VSV感染BHK-21细胞后,光镜下可见细胞圆缩,细胞器固缩、核仁消失、染色质凝聚和核碎裂、凋亡小体出现;电镜下观察到染色质聚集形成典型的新月形,胞浆中充满大量空泡,细胞核因染色质凝聚也发生了空泡化;1%的琼脂糖凝胶电泳出现180-200bp整倍数的DNA梯形条带。结果表明,VSV诱导BHK-21细胞凋亡是其致细胞病变的主要表现形式之一。
The apoptosis of BHK-21 cells infected by vesicular stomatitis virus was observed by technique of HE,Giemsa staining,electron microscope of transmission and agarose gel electrophoresis of DNA, The results showed that BHK-21 cells infected with vesicular stomatitis virus (VSV) appeared cell shrunken,organelle condensed ,nucleoli vanished ,chromatin congregated and nuclei fragmentated and the apoptotic bodies presented under optical microscope ;Under electron microscope,the collection of chromatin forms typical lunule. Mass vacuoles were full of cytoplasm and nucleolus because of the congregated chromatin. Agarose gel electrophoresis of DNA extracted from infected BHK-21 cells revealed typical 180-200 bp integer-fold "ladder" bands. The results indicated that apoptosis is the most form of cytopathogenic effect that induced by VSV in BHK-21 ceils.
